Font Size: a A A

Design And Realization Of Graduate Employment System Based On J2EE Framework And Mixed Model

Posted on:2007-07-16Degree:MasterType:Thesis
Country:ChinaCandidate:X H MoFull Text:PDF
GTID:2178360185450069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
With the development of network, the development of web application system, especially the enterprise web application system, has become an important field of software developments. The enterprise web application system always requires an excellent architecture, more accumulation of the technology and the experience, more rigorous management of the project. But the traditional development modes of web application system do not commendably meet those requirements. So some developers bring forward a new development mode of web application system that is based on the web application framework, and developed some characteristic web application framework. This paper brings forward a new web application framework aiming at the enterprise web application, which can resolve many problems in the development of the enterprise web application.Firstly, this paper designs and implements a web application framework based on J2EE platform with the ideas about software architecture, framework, design pattern, and object-oriented. The framework adopts the idea of MVC pattern and Model 2 architecture. With the framework, the development of web application system will get many advantages, including clear software architecture modularize configure, uniform accessing mode of application model, many processing mode of view, excel expansibility and maintenance, and sustain separation of roles of developer, etc.Secondly, this paper introduces the emergence, architecture and properties of EJB as well as lucubrate the EJB in persistence best practices and EJB best practices and performance optimizations and component restriction. The result of research set up some strategies and regulation. The paper combined the EJB and the development technology of electronic business application. Based on the upper architecture, the system of Graduate Employment is successfully implemented, and many problems in the development are resolved.At last, Research of database connection pools technology in web application is done in this paper. Both client-managing and self-managing classes of database connection pools are implemented to optimize the performance of the system. Based on the research of request/response model of HTTP protocol, session tracking and processing technology is used to implement access only to authorized users, and policy of resource access control and form-based authentication are combined to implement the security manager module in the system.
Keywords/Search Tags:Java 2 Enterprise Edition, Client/Server, Browser/Server, Model-View-Controller
PDF Full Text Request
Related items